China vows action against ‘blind’ electric vehicle growth

June 15, 2018

Via: Reuters

China is aggressively pushing the new energy vehicle (NEV) sector as it tries to not only cut air pollution from traditional combustion engines but also boost China’s high-tech clout.

But experts have warned the sector is facing overcapacity risks, with as many as 102 firms producing 355 different kinds of electric, hybrid and fuel cell vehicles by the end of March, according to industry ministry data.

Meng Wei, spokeswoman with the National Development and Reform Commission (NDRC), told reporters at a briefing in Beijing that China will adjust industry entry thresholds, strengthen corporate responsibility and improve government supervision to help bring order to the sector.
